WALTERBORO: Mrs. Grace Crosby Sanders, widow of the late Eugene William "Billy" Sanders Jr., passed away at her home Monday morning, November 21, 2022 under hospice care, with her family by her side.  She was 93.

Mrs. Sanders was born in Walterboro April 4, 1929 a daughter of the late Stephen Martin Crosby and Fay Rebecca Crosby.  She was a homemaker, and was a devoted wife, mother and grandmother who loved spending time at her home on Edisto Beach. She was an active member of the First Baptist Church of Walterboro.
